Get in Touch** The Mercedes-Benz repair market in the East Windsor, CT area is characterized by a clear tiered structure. At the top is the authorized dealership (**Mercedes-Benz of Hartford**), which offers the pinnacle of factory-backed expertise and technology at a premium price point. The middle ground is dominated by highly specialized independent shops like **Imported Cars Limited**, which provide dealer-level technical skill for Mercedes-Benz specifically, often at 20-40% lower labor rates. Finally, reputable generalists like **Precision Tune Auto Care** in East Windsor itself provide a valuable option for more routine services and repairs, offering convenience and competitive pricing for owners of older models or those seeking a trusted local relationship. Competition is healthy, driving a focus on customer service and technical capability. Pricing reflects this stratification: dealership labor rates are typically the highest ($200-$250/hr), specialized independents are moderately high ($150-$190/hr), and skilled generalists are more accessible ($120-$150/hr). For owners of complex models with AIRMATIC, AMG engines, or advanced electronics, the investment in a specialist like Imported Cars Limited is often justified by their targeted expertise and efficiency.

In East Windsor, we frequently address issues with the AIRMATIC suspension system, which can be stressed by our variable New England climate and road conditions. Electrical glitches in COMAND systems and oil leaks from seals are also prevalent, with winter road salt accelerating corrosion concerns.
Choosing a reputable independent Mercedes-Benz specialist in East Windsor typically offers significant savings, often 30-50% less than dealership labor rates, while still using OEM or high-quality parts. This allows you to access expert care locally without the premium of traveling to a metro-area dealership.
For all routine maintenance, diagnostics, and most repairs, a qualified independent shop in East Windsor is fully capable. The primary reason to visit an authorized dealership is for warranty-covered work, complex software updates, or specific recall campaigns that require proprietary manufacturer tools.
Look for a shop with Mercedes-Benz-specific diagnostic tools (like STAR), technicians with Mercedes-Benz training/certifications, and a reputation for clear communication. Checking reviews and asking if they use OEM or OEM-equivalent parts will ensure you receive proper care.
Yes, scheduling ahead for seasonal services like pre-winter brake checks or spring alignment checks after pothole season is wise due to high demand. Using a local shop also provides quicker turnaround for seasonal tire changes, protecting your alloy wheels from winter salt damage.
